    The oldest and most famous temple in Echigo This is a temple of the Shingon sect located halfway up Mt. In addition to the main hall, the temple grounds are lined with stately buildings such as Kyakuden (guest hall), Rokkakudo (hexagonal hall), Daishi-do (hall for priests), Zenjikyodo (hall for Buddhist sutras), Belfry-do (bell tower), and the Hall of Treasures. Legend has it that Shuten Doji was a child of this temple. In 2009, the temple celebrated the 1,300th anniversary of its founding. Telephone number/0256-97-3758 Website/Kokusho-ji Temple
